An Emerging Ethical and Religious Response to the Global Refugee Crisis
Rev. Paula Maiorano

This service reflects on the book Humanity in Crisis through the lens of Unitarian Universalist values for human rights and vision of Beloved Community.

The book was published in late 2019 by David Hollenbach, SJ, Senior Fellow of the Berkeley Center for Religion, Peace, and World Affairs and affiliated Professor of Theology at Georgetown University.

The main thrust of the book is the emerging crisis for all of humanity of today’s millions of men, women, and children who live in extreme humanitarian crisis due to social, political, or environmental conditions.
